absorbing | extremely interesting; holding one's attention; fascinating |
astonishing | causing overpowering wonder; surprising; amazing; astounding |
bequest | property left one in a will; legacy |
evolve | to develop gradually; to unfold |
expenditure | money which is paid out; anything which is spent |
forfeit | to lose as a result of error, fault, crime etc. |
hazard | risk or danger, especially that which is beyond one's control |
ideal | perfect; lacking nothing; excellent; faultless |
stimulate | to rouse to action; to excite, goad, or urge |
version | an account of something; a particular form |
